About this Role
Deputy Manager – Preschool
Parkland Primary School
Salary: Grade 7 Pay Point 11-14
Hours: 21 Hours per week, 39 Weeks per year
Contract Type: Permanent
Working Pattern: Monday, Thursday and Friday 07:30- 15:30 with 2 x 15-minute breaks.
About the Role
As Deputy Manager, you will support the day-to-day leadership and operation of the preschool, ensuring children receive the highest quality care and learning opportunities. You will lead by example, inspire colleagues, build positive relationships with families, and help create a warm, inclusive environment where every child can thrive

Key Responsibilities
- Understand, effectively apply, and support the Pre-School Manager with implementing the Trust policies and procedures related to the post especially those that relate to safeguarding and child protection.
- Ensure compliance under the Children’s Act.
- Assist the Pre-School Manager with implementing a multi-cultural play curriculum to stimulate children’s interest in learning.
What We’re Looking For
Qualifications:
- Minimum NVQ level 3 in Children’s Care, Learning and Development, or relevant degree.
- Level 2 qualifications in maths/numeracy and English/literacy
Experience:
- Minimum of 2 years experience of working with under fives in a formal setting, working within the Nursery Education and meeting the requirements relating to Ofsted.
- Experience of leading activities with individuals, groups and whole classes to support children’s development
- Ability to write reports
- Ability to lead a team of adults
Skills & Knowledge:
- Knowledge of and the ability to apply child protection and health and safety procedure
- Knowledge of current legislation affecting care and education of under fives
- Knowledge of planning an appropriate curriculum to promote the desirable outcomes/ Early Learning Goals
- Knowledge and understanding of children’s development 0-5years.
